As the UX/UI Designer for Sinders Bridal House, I redesign the website, created and launch it, through the UX process of creating this new, user-friendly, responsive web design.
Project objective: Create a website to get their name and information out to people.
Promote who they are and what they offer. Encourage their clients to use the website.
Increase their clients and therefore, more sales.
Target Audience: People wants to have their own business
Primary: Young ladies
Secondary: Women in all ages
To showcase their support and years of experience in business, we added a services section to their website, featuring three key areas: classes, mentoring packages, and partnerships. Each section offers a variety of classes and events that clients can conveniently book online.
My web design focuses on creating an intuitive and engaging experience that allows the audience to easily explore and understand the services offered. By using clear navigation, visually appealing layouts, and concise messaging, the website guides visitors seamlessly through each section—whether it’s learning about classes, exploring mentoring packages, or discovering partnership opportunities. With a user-centered approach, the design highlights key services while making it simple for clients to book and connect, ultimately enhancing their overall experience and engagement with the brand.
